    The Guam Regional Medical City (GRMC) is a 136-bed private hospital in Dededo, Guam. It is managed under the Philippines -based hospital network, The Medical City . It serves the US territory of Guam as well as neighboring Micronesia , the Northern Marianas , Palau and the Marshall Islands .

    The Guam Department of Public Health and Social Services (Chamorro: Dipattamenton Salut Pupbleko Yan Setbision Susiat) is an agency of the government of the United States territory of Guam.
